Transaction 143568db690f04e9a087b7b4dbe829fa2bec75b60b8fcb597514644a1a55e901
1 Input
1 Output
-
143568db690f04e9a087b7b4dbe829fa2bec75b60b8fcb597514644a1a55e901:0
- value
- 2622442
- script pubkey
- OP_0 OP_PUSHBYTES_20 715b97952ffb92e0ac923c816d620e2ac9f3116b
- address
- bc1qw9de09f0lwfwptyj8jqk6csw9tylxyttrl6ws3